Security Agencies Must Avoid Disharmony – Tinubu

Nigeria’s President, Bola Tinubu has come out to warn security agencies against disharmony and intelligence hoarding.

He recently revealed that these practices frustrate Nigeria’s counterterrorism efforts, and Nigerians have been reacting.

According to him, just like it is unwise to have disharmony in an orchestra, the army must continually work on focusing on one tunnel, sharing information and sharing intelligence at all times.

Tinubu added that the effort of the entire Nigerian armed forces must be put together in a way that there will be one single focus on securing the country.

His words, “You can’t have disharmony in an orchestra. We must focus on one tunnel…share information, share intelligence. You cannot hoard information. You cannot hoard intelligence.”

“The effort of the entire armed forces of this country must be put together in a way that there will be one single focus on securing the country.”

“You can’t have disharmony in an orchestra. We must focus on one tunnel; coordinate, share information, share intelligence, and work harder.”

“You cannot hoard information. You cannot hoard intelligence. I am glad that Nigeria is on the path to success. We will, I assure you. We will make it a priority and that is why I am here this morning.”

“Terrorism is not unique to Nigeria alone. It is across the world and we have to fight it. We have to eliminate it. If we as Nigerians are looking for economic revival, prosperity, and development, then we have to give priority to security.”

“What I have seen here is a demonstration of intelligence efforts to counter-terrorism. This must be backed by knowledge.”

“Counter-terrorism that is not backed by knowledge and intelligence is not going to be of any service to any nation. We are going to work on that together.”
